| CPC G06F 9/542 (2013.01) [G06F 9/45558 (2013.01); G06F 9/4881 (2013.01); G06F 9/54 (2013.01); G06F 16/2272 (2019.01); G06F 16/2379 (2019.01); G06F 16/27 (2019.01); G06F 16/278 (2019.01); H04L 12/2881 (2013.01); H04L 12/44 (2013.01); H04L 12/462 (2013.01); H04L 12/4633 (2013.01); H04L 12/4641 (2013.01); H04L 12/66 (2013.01); H04L 45/02 (2013.01); H04L 45/08 (2013.01); H04L 45/22 (2013.01); H04L 45/24 (2013.01); H04L 45/26 (2013.01); H04L 45/28 (2013.01); H04L 45/48 (2013.01); H04L 45/50 (2013.01); H04L 45/586 (2013.01); H04L 45/66 (2013.01); H04L 45/745 (2013.01); H04L 47/125 (2013.01); H04L 63/0272 (2013.01); H04L 67/1097 (2013.01); H04L 67/55 (2022.05); G06F 2009/45595 (2013.01); H04L 2012/4629 (2013.01); H04L 49/25 (2013.01)] | 19 Claims |

|
1. A system comprising:
a plurality of bare metal servers each executing a virtual customer edge router, a plurality of host virtual machines, and a hypervisor; and
a plurality of leaf nodes, each having a physical connection to one or more of the plurality of bare metal servers and connected to the virtual customer edge router of each bare metal server of the plurality of bare metal servers by layer-3 router links;
wherein the virtual customer edge router of each bare metal server of the plurality of bare metal servers is configured to terminate layer-2 routes of the plurality of host virtual machines of the each bare metal server;
wherein each virtual customer edge router of each bare metal server of the plurality of bare metal servers is configured with a same anycast gateway internet protocol (IP) address and medium access code (MAC) address.
|